  1. Espresso-based drinks: Espresso-based drinks are popular among coffee lovers in Downtown Charleston. These drinks include lattes, cappuccinos, and Americanos. They are made by forcing hot water through finely-ground coffee beans, resulting in a concentrated coffee flavor. Many cafes in the area serve unique variations, such as flavored lattes or macchiatos with spices. According to a 2021 survey by the Specialty Coffee Association (SCA), espresso drinks account for over 50% of coffee consumption in urban cafes.

  2. Cold brews: Cold brews are favored for their smooth and refreshing taste. Made by steeping coarsely-ground coffee beans in cold water for an extended period, this method produces a rich flavor with lower acidity. Many customers appreciate cold brews as a versatile base for different flavors. The SCA reported that cold brew sales increased by 50% from 2015 to 2019, highlighting its growing popularity among consumers looking for refreshing coffee options.

  3. Single-origin coffees: Single-origin coffees are sourced from a specific region or farm, offering distinct flavor profiles that reflect the local climate and soil. This variety attracts coffee enthusiasts who aim to explore different taste nuances. Cafes throughout Downtown Charleston showcase single-origin options from places like Ethiopia, Colombia, and Guatemala. A 2020 report from the International Coffee Organization found that consumers are increasingly interested in the origins and quality of their coffee.

  4. Nitro coffee: Nitro coffee has gained popularity for its creamy texture and frothy head, achieved by infusing cold brew coffee with nitrogen gas. This method enhances the drinking experience and offers a unique alternative to traditional iced coffee. According to market research by Technavio, the nitro coffee market is projected to grow significantly, as consumers seek innovative beverage options.

  5. Plant-based milk options: Plant-based milk options such as oat, almond, and coconut milk are increasingly requested by customers with dietary preferences. Many cafes in Downtown Charleston offer a variety of these alternatives. A 2021 market report by Grand View Research indicated that the plant-based milk sector has experienced significant growth, driven by rising health consciousness and environmental awareness among consumers.

  6. Seasonal flavors: Seasonal flavors often attract customers seeking novelty in their coffee experiences. Popular seasonal items include pumpkin spice lattes in the fall and mint-infused drinks during winter holidays. Research by Datassential suggests that unique seasonal offerings can boost customer visits, with over 60% of respondents saying they enjoy seasonal menu items at their favorite cafes.

  7. Locally roasted blends: Locally roasted blends are celebrated for their freshness and unique flavor profiles. Many cafes in Downtown Charleston partner with local roasters to provide patrons with premium coffee. A study by the Coffee Quality Institute found that consumers often prefer locally sourced products, believing they support the community and receive higher quality.

These favorite coffee varieties demonstrate a blend of tradition and innovation, appealing to diverse customer preferences throughout Downtown Charleston.

Which Places Are Famous for Their Signature Coffee Blends?

Certain places around the world are famous for their signature coffee blends, each offering unique flavors and brewing styles.

  1. Ethiopia
  2. Colombia
  3. Brazil
  4. Jamaica
  5. Costa Rica
  6. Hawaii

The significance of these locations lies in their rich coffee-growing heritage and distinct blends, which are influenced by local climatic conditions and cultivation practices.

  1. Ethiopia:
    Ethiopia is often considered the birthplace of coffee. Its coffee is known for its unique flavors, including fruity and floral notes. The country’s diverse coffee-growing regions, such as Sidamo and Yirgacheffe, contribute to its wide range of coffee profiles. A study from the Specialty Coffee Association notes that Ethiopian coffee plays an integral role in specialty coffee markets due to its complexity and taste diversity.

  2. Colombia:
    Colombia is renowned for its smooth, mild coffee blends. The country’s mountain ranges provide ideal conditions for coffee cultivation. Colombian coffee is often characterized by a balanced acidity and nutty undertones. The National Federation of Coffee Growers of Colombia highlights that Colombian coffee is consistently ranked among the best in the world, largely due to its rigorous quality standards.

  3. Brazil:
    Brazil is the largest coffee producer globally, known for its signature espresso blends. Brazilian coffees typically possess chocolatey and nutty flavors, often enjoyed in blends rather than single origin. According to the Brazilian Institute of Coffee, the vast sizes of Brazilian coffee farms allow for mass production, which influences flavor profiles, as well as pricing and accessibility.

  4. Jamaica:
    Jamaica is famous for its Blue Mountain coffee, which is considered one of the highest quality coffee varieties available. The coffee is grown in the Blue Mountains and is known for its mild flavor and lack of bitterness. Reports from the Coffee Industry Board of Jamaica indicate that the limited production and high demand drive its premium price.

  5. Costa Rica:
    Costa Rica takes pride in high-quality Arabica beans, known for their bright acidity and fruity flavors. The country’s coffee is often shade-grown, promoting biodiversity. The Costa Rican Coffee Institute emphasizes sustainability and quality, aiming for international recognition of its coffee blends.

  6. Hawaii:
    Hawaiian coffee, particularly Kona coffee, is celebrated for its smooth taste and rich body. Grown in specific districts on the Big Island, Kona coffee is often described as having a hint of nuttiness and a mild flavor profile. The Kona Coffee Farmers Association promotes local farming practices that enhance the quality, making it a sought-after coffee blend in global markets.
